I spent much of my time looking at the possibility of having surgery in the states or in Mexico. To have surgery in the states I would need to gain more weight, develop full blown diabetes (right now I am borderline) and have another weight related health problem. After scrutinizing three Mexico doctors and their patient reviews, here on Obesity Help, and on youtube, I chose Dr Alvarez. I ended up asking Susan the coordinator, a ton of questions, and she was good about getting back to me, and helping me understand things, she is great.
We (me and my husband) were picked up at the San Antonio, La Quinta by Rosy. It was a long drive, but I did not mind at all because I would rather have someone in the driver’s seat that knows where we are going, with experience, and she did that well. Rosy had already informed us what to do and what not to do when went through customs. On going across the border I was expecting what I had seen years ago on some of the major border crossings, once inside Mexico, chaos, children selling stuff, a lot of movement. This was not the case at all, I have to repeat, it was calm and quiet and uneventful, and there was very little traffic. The border patrol knew Rosy and she handled everything.
We met with Dr Alvarez, and from there it was just a matter of procedures, weight, blood, and x-ray. Because I was so nervous the time seemed to drag, but once I was given the drip for the OR, I remember trying to get onto the gurney, from there, I awoke, and had to ask, did I really have surgery? My husband said I asked everyone that came in the room the same question. I was surprised to find out from my husband that before the doctor could do the surgery he also had to repair a hiatal hernia.
The care I received was outstanding, I kept accidentally hitting the call button, and always someone would show up. I saw Dr Alvarez and two of his associates the two days I was there. What I really liked is that the staff at the hospital was so quiet, professional and helpful. The rooms are set in an alcove, sort of away from the hallway. My room was private as was the bathroom and shower.
The only thing that went wrong was my IV insertion, which I have had a problem with the insertion once before here in the states. It was very painful and eventually became infiltrated. Because I was still feeling the drugs of OR, I don’t remember but my husband said that I would not let anyone take out the IV and redo the right hand, unless the doctor did it himself. My husband said that Dr Alvarez showed up later in his regular clothes, I remember him coming in and telling me the IV had to be switched or I would become dehydrated. It was then changed to my right hand, after that there were no more problems with it. If you have any medical issues do let them know so you won’t have a problem like I did.
I am extremely happy that I chose Dr Alvarez and his staff, they were all very professional. My husband is thoroughly impressed with the care I received. Jessica even ordered dinner for him on the second day. Everybody, from Susan, my first contact, to Rosy, the driver, to Dr Alvarez and his two associates, his assistants, Annali, and Jessica. They all speak perfect English. Dr Alvarez keeps in touch and has been updating me on when to move on to the next level of my food intake.
If you are contemplating having this surgery, I highly recommend Dr Alvarez, you won’t regret it, I know I don’t. I am happy I made this choice, and I am feeling good about life and eating less.
